  • Understanding Radon and Its Health Risks

    Although you can't see or smell it, radon is a harmful radioactive gas that forms naturally from the decay of uranium in soil, rock, and water. When radon leaks into your living space, it can accumulate in the indoor air, especially in lower levels like basements or crawl spaces. Prolonged exposure to high radon levels creates significant health dangers, as radon is the leading cause of lung cancer among individuals who have never smoked. You need to understand that even minimal concentrations of radon in indoor air can be hazardous over time, because the gas releases radioactive particles that harm lung tissue when breathed in.     Home Prevention Steps

    While radon remains invisible and odorless, its potential to cause significant health concerns makes proactive testing a crucial safety precaution in New Brunswick homes. You need to be aware of radon risks and implement preventive home strategies to safeguard your family. Start by ensuring you have effective ventilation systems—adding or upgrading mechanical ventilation systems can help reducing radon concentrations, especially in basements and crawl spaces. Seal cracks in floors and walls to minimize radon entry points. If you are building a new home, require radon resistant construction approaches, such as gas-permeable layers and vent pipes, to prevent future risks. Regular radon testing validates whether these measures are effective. By utilizing these technical solutions, you'll markedly decrease radon exposure and improve your home's safety.

    Main Sources of Radon throughout the Sainte Rose, Bathurst, and Miramichi regions

    A major source of radon in our local regions originates from the natural decomposition of uranium in the local soil and rock. When uranium decays, it releases radon gas, which can seep through cracks in your foundation, pipe penetrations, or exposed flooring. Once inside, radon collects in your indoor air, specifically in basements and lower living areas where ventilation is restricted. Poorly designed and upkeep of ventilation systems can increase the problem, as they may fail to clear out radon-laden air efficiently. You should monitor spots where the ground contacts your home's structure, as these points are most vulnerable.     The Testing Process: A Homeowner's Overview

    Prior to beginning radon testing, you should know that the process calls for careful planning and strict adherence to safety protocols. If you own a home, you need to learn about standard testing procedures to obtain accurate results. Experts typically suggest placing a detector in the lowest habitable space of your home, clear of drafts, high humidity, or direct sunlight. Depending on the selected approach—short-term or long-term—testing equipment remains anywhere from days to months.

    It's important to ensure normal closed-house conditions, which means keeping windows and exterior doors closed to the extent possible during the test.     What's the Expected Duration for Radon Test Results?

    When conducting a radon test, the testing period typically ranges from 48 hours for brief testing periods to 90 days or greater for prolonged evaluation. After the testing period, results delivery is determined by the testing approach—electronic monitors can give you immediate results, while lab-analyzed kits usually take 1 to 2 weeks.     Do I Need a Professional for Radon Testing or Can I Handle It?

    You can perform radon testing on your own using DIY testing kits, which can be found easily and are straightforward to use. However, for the most accurate results and thorough analysis, it's recommended to choose a professional inspection. Certified professionals use calibrated equipment, follow strict protocols, and provide thorough reports.
